Blacktop Sealing in Fort Collins, CO
Blacktop sealing is a process that involves appl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ces such as driveways, parking areas, and pathways. This service helps to extend the lifespan of the asphalt by providing a barrier against water, UV rays, and other elements that can cause cracking, fading, and deterioration over time. Property owners often seek blacktop sealing to maintain the appearance of their surfaces, prevent costly repairs, and improve curb appeal for residential and commercial properties alike.
Before requesting blacktop sealing, property owners typically want to understand the condition of their existing asphalt, including any cracks or damage that may need repair prior to sealing. It’s also helpful to know the appropriate timing for sealing, usually after the surface has been properly cleaned and any necessary repairs are completed. Clear communication about the scope of the project, including the size of the area and the type of sealant used, can ensure the best results and long-lasting protection for the asphalt surface.

Blacktop Sealing Questions
What surfaces can be sealed with blacktop sealing? Blacktop sealing is typically applied to driveways, parking lots, and other asphalt surfaces to protect against damage and wear.
Why is sealing asphalt important? Sealing helps prevent water penetration, reduces cracking, and extends the lifespan of the asphalt surface.
How often should asphalt be resealed? Asphalt surfaces generally benefit from resealing every 2 to 3 years to maintain protection and appearance.
What preparation is needed before sealing? The surface should be clean, free of debris, and dry to ensure proper adhesion of the sealant.
